Ingredients

  • 1.5 lbs cauliflower, washed and cut into 3-inch pieces
  • 1/2 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/2 tbsp kosher salt
  • 1 t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p paprika
  • 1/2 tsp cayenne pepper (optional)
  • 1/2 cup olive oil, divided in half

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Preheat the oven to 450°F (230°C) and place an empty baking sheet inside to heat. Prepare the cauliflower by cutting or tearing it into 3-inch florets, making sure each piece has a flat side to help develop a crispy crust.
  2. Step 2: In a large bowl, toss the cauliflower with 1/4 cup of olive oil, kosher salt, black pepper, garlic powder, paprika, and cayenne pepper if using. Mix thoroughly to coat all the pieces evenly.
  3. Step 3: Carefully remove the hot baking sheet from the oven and drizzle the remaining 1/4 cup of olive oil evenly across its surface.
  4. Step 4: Arrange the cauliflower on the baking sheet with the flat sides down. This helps create maximum contact for crispiness.
  5. Step 5: Roast the cauliflower for 25–30 minutes, flipping the pieces once about halfway through, until they are golden brown and crispy.

Tips & Variations

  • For extra crispiness, avoid overcrowding the baking sheet so the cauliflower steams less and roasts more.
  • Swap paprika for smoked paprika to add a smoky depth of flavor.
  • Add a squeeze of lemon juice or sprinkle fresh parsley after roasting for brightness.
  • If you prefer less heat, omit the cayenne pepper or reduce the amount.

Storage

Store leftover roasted cauliflower in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, place it on a baking sheet and warm in a 400°F (200°C) oven for 5–7 minutes to help retain crispiness. Microwaving will make it soft and lose texture.

FAQs

Can I use frozen cauliflower for this recipe?

Frozen cauliflower tends to release more water when roasted, which can prevent crispiness. For best results, use fresh cauliflower.

How do I make the cauliflower less spicy?

Simply omit the cayenne pepper or reduce the amount to suit your taste. The paprika adds mild warmth without overwhelming heat.
